Musician Talk explores blog topics covered by Travis Brant. Travis is an American drummer, composer, co-founder of the band Axon Radio, and Billboard / Mediabase top 40 recording artist. Travis' recorded works include collaborations with contemporary jazz icons Gerald Albright, Michael Lington, Darren Rahn, Paul Brown, and fusion guitarist Oz Noy. Vince Ector – Drummer, Composer, Educator [Video Version]
Vince Ector is currently in demand as a recording musician and as a performer at jazz festivals throughout the world with numerous international artists such as, The Dizzy Gillespie Alumni All Stars & Big Band, Stanley Cowell, Houston Person, Antonio Hart, Bruce Williams, Bobby Watson & Horizon, Steve Miller, Jose Feliciano, Nat Adderley Jr., Lou Donaldson and The Vince Ector "Organatomy" Band.

Bryan Meyers – Drummer, Composer, Producer [Audio Version]
Bryan Meyers is a Los Angeles-based drummer, composer, producer and solo artist. He has recorded and/or played live with Mike Roe, Danny Flanagan+the Rain Chorus, The Why Store, Mike Campese, Dave Kerzner, Robert Watson, Kevin Chokan, Little Dove and more.
